Brake resistors are devices which are introduced within a machine to assist in slowing down or stopping a movement quickly and safely. This excess energy is absorbed by brake resistors, generating heat and thus making the machine stop at a proper rate and in safe conditions. 

How They Work and Why They are Importan?

Materials brake resistors use to store and release the energy in the form of heat. The brake resistor turns on to apply its job, when a machine needs to stop. As the energy accumulated by the machine, exits in the form of electricity it passes through the resistor that turns it into heat. This helps the machine to slow down gently and for the engine to turn off quietly with out any damage or issues.
